The President of the Moscow Chamber of Commerce and Industry, Mr.Vladimir Platonov, was one of the main speakers of the event "Russia-Iran: Expanding Opportunities,”which took place on October 19, during the International Export Forum "Made in Russia”.
Russia's interaction with Iran concerns a strategic partnership in trade, regional agenda, logistics, the financial and banking sectors, with new growth, development and cooperation on all levels.
“Iran, as Russia's economic partner, plays different roles. For example: it has a great potential in industrial cooperation - in the automotive, aircraft, gas and construction sectors. Iran is also a significant logistical partner for the formation of alternative ways of transportation of goods. Therefore, bilateral support of our business communities is important for the Russian Exporting Center as a developmental institution," said Mr. Dmitry Prokhorenko, the moderator of the event, Director for Foreign Network Development of the REC Group.
The session participants discussed the prospects for the development of trade and economic relations between Russia and Iran, available state support for business, including insurance and credit-guarantees, investment cooperation, optimization of logistics and development of transit through Iran to third countries, as well as interaction between the customs authorities of the two countries.
Cooperation between the economies of Russia and Iran has a huge potential for development by expanding business interaction between the two countries," said Mr. Platonov. He noted that the Moscow Chamber of Commerce and Industry actively pursues cooperation with a number of Iranian regions and, using the opportunities of the Russian CCI system, enables to share emerging opportunities for cooperation with Russian regions.The President of the MCCI also told representatives of the Iranian and Russian business community about the possibilities of the new MCCI project of working with foreign students, teaching them business skills and gradually involving them in foreign economic activities.

Later, during the Forum, the Moscow Chamber of Commerce and Industry signed a Memorandum of Cooperation with the Chamber of Commerce, Industry, Subsoil and Agriculture of Tehran. This document envisages intensification of cooperation between the two Chambers in order to develop the economies of both cities. The Memorandum addresses spheres of trade, tourism, agriculture, innovation, investment and technology, as well as the establishment of direct and effective business relations between Moscow’s and Tehran’s entrepreneurs.
This is the seventh cooperation agreement between the Moscow Chamber of Commerce and Industry and the colleagues of various provinces of Iran, which is an obvious evidence of the growing role of business partnership between the business community of Moscow and its Iranian colleagues.
